I was at the Modified Nationals Car Show recently and stumbled upon a stage where a fire breathing act was about to begin. These black and white photographs are the result of me being in the right place at the right time with my camera in hand and I’m really pleased with them.
I managed to capture the fire in mid-air by using a fast shutter speed, shot at f2.8 to blur the background and converted them to black and white in Adobe Lightroom. I liked the colour versions too with the flames bright orange but the black and white’s stood out a little more for me.
